Scott,
We’ve kicked this around a bit here and there on the board.
There are those who have a good gimmick, can talk a bit and are good enough but then the bell rings.
I’m not saying we need ********** work or whatever, but wrestlers where it comes apart in the ring.
Likee now, Elias, Lacey Evans and Alexa Bliss, according to most.
Who are the most prominent examples that you think this would apply to, past or present?
It definitely happened to Bray Wyatt. He wasn't, like, TERRIBLE, but after all the buildup and novelty of the original character wore off, he was clearly just another guy in there and he was never able to rise past it.
Historically, Nikita Koloff was a great example, where he had this amazing aura when he first started but couldn't back it up in the ring. But here's the difference: They decided to turn that into a strength by having him destroy guys in 30 seconds on TV so that his matches were kept short. And then eventually he did get pretty good.
